In 2016,Journal of Enzyme Inhibition and Medicinal Chemistry included an article by Gul, Halise Inci; Tugrak, Mehtap; Sakagami, Hiroshi. Category: piperazines. The article was titled 《Synthesis of some acrylophenones with N-methylpiperazine and evaluation of their cytotoxicities》. The information in the text is summarized as follows:
In this study, the compounds having acrylophenone structure, 1-aryl-2-(N-methylpiperazinomethyl)-2-propen-1-one dihydrochlorides, were synthesized and their chem. structures were identified with 1H NMR, 13C NMR and HRMS spectra. The cytotoxicities of the compounds were tested towards Ca9-22 (human gingival carcinoma), HSC-2 (human oral squamous carcinoma), HSC-3 (human oral squamous carcinoma) and HSC-4 (human oral squamous carcinoma) cell lines as tumor cell lines and HGF (gingival fibroblasts), HPLF (periodontal ligament fibroblasts) and HPC (pulp cells) cell lines as non-tumor cell lines. PSE of the compound TA2 which has a Me substituent on Ph ring, pointed out the compound TA2 as a leader compound to be considered.
